Table of Conversion 1 degree = 60 minutes 1 minute = 60 seconds 1 degree = 3600 seconds Example: Convert 12.456 degrees into degrees, minutes and seconds 12.456 degrees = 12 degrees + 0.456 degrees = 12 degrees + 0.456 × 60 minutes = 12 degrees + 27.36 minutes = 12 degrees + 27 minutes + 0.36 minutes = 12 degrees + 27 minutes + 0.36 × 60 . Symbols Used: degree ° - minute ' - second " There are 360° in a full circle 1° = 60' (one degree = 60 minutes) 1° = 3600" (one degree = 3600 seconds) 1' = 60" (one minute = 60 seconds) 34° 12' 12" = 34.2033° in decimal format An angle of 180° is called a straight angle An angle of 90° is called a right angle. 2. Informally, specifying a geographic location usually means giving the location's latitude and longitude.The numerical values for latitude and longitude can occur in a number of different units or formats: sexagesimal degree: degrees, minutes, and seconds : 40° 26′ 46″ N 79° 58′ 56″ W; degrees and decimal minutes: 40° 26.767′ N 79° 58.933′ W .
